**Ticket: Expired credentials on Fernwheel transcode farm**

As discussed at the sync: the worker nodes in the Fernwheel transcoding farm stopped pulling jobs Tuesday because the `transcode-dispatch` service credential lapsed silently. We've added expiry alerting and confirmed all twelve nodes recover after re-auth. For anyone validating the fix this week, authenticate the dispatch client with the replacement key below.

app token of badug-tahaf = qvz11-nP5FBNr8qnh

### Changelog — Pathwright Dispatch v2.4

Renamed `ASSIGN_SCORE_KEY` to `HEURISTIC_AUTH_KEY` to clarify that it authenticates the driver-assignment heuristic service, not the scoring cache. New team members: update local env files accordingly; the old name is ignored as of this release. The renamed variable and its value appear on the following line.

sealed setting: VAULT_KEY5=54f99

For contractors joining the Mistlewood digest project: the batch email scheduler's old setting `DIGEST_CRON_WINDOW` has been renamed to `DIGEST_DISPATCH_WINDOW` to match the dispatcher service's terminology. The old name still works but logs a deprecation warning and will be removed in 4.0. Please update any env files you've copied from earlier branches, and double-check the timezone suffix — several missed digests last quarter traced back to that. The dispatcher also authenticates to the mail relay, so your env file needs this line:

secret setting of bageg-bagag: ARCHIVE_KEY3=e2f

Subject: DR drill — broker upgrade rehearsal (Fennwick)

Hi,

The disaster-recovery drill for the Fennwick broker upgrade runs Tuesday at 09:00. We will fail over to the standby cluster, apply the 5.2 upgrade, and replay the backlog. Release notes should not ship until replay lag reaches zero. Rollback snapshots are already staged. As release manager, you will need to unseal the standby cluster's config vault at the start of the drill, using the recovery passphrase below.

vault phrase of taweg-kafof = oliax-zorael